Local Bus Services
Buses within and around town, to the schools, holiday parks and car parks depart from Royal Square. This is opposite the Western Hotel and the Royal Cinema.

Buses between St Ives and other local towns such as Penzance, Camborne, Redruth and Truro depart from the bus station which is next to the entrance to the railway station car park.

Local firm Oates Travel run excursions to a variety of destinations, plus a regular shopping trip coach to Truro. Further details of their services are also below.

Bus services between St Ives and other local towns are operated by Western Greyhound and First Group. Timetables and more information are on their websites.

Cross-country routes are operated by National Express Coaches. You can get a connecting service from most cities in the UK to Exeter or Plymouth, then travel straight on into St Ives.

Local Coach Services - Oates Travel
Oates Travel offer a range of day trips and tours from their base in town. These include Eden Project, Lost Gardens of Heligan, Minack Theatre and Tintagel.

This is a great way to get to these attractions, particularly as some trips include your entry ticket so that you can avoid the queues.

With a fleet of modern vehicles from 8 to 49 seaters, they also offer a range of other services - coach hire, port and airport transfers, incoming tour organisation and coach holidays throughout the UK and Europe.

   
Local Bus Services - Western Greyhound
A local independent bus and coach company who run bus services, coach day trips and offer a private hire service.

They run a bus service (route 501) along the north coast from Newquay to St Ives, via Hendra Holiday Park, Perranporth, Hayle and several other stops. This might be particularly useful if you are staying out of town but want a day in St Ives.

   
National Coach Services
Coaches run regularly to and from town from destinations all over the UK, operated by National Express. These arrive at and depart from the bus station next to the railway station (see above).

The National Express website has details and timetables. Some services involve changes at Bristol or Plymouth.
